Output 5435a83da4eeb69845a01675686a3007811821b177d056ff4a8ad50d4968578c:0

value
25576865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afb7643e088c97f00dfd1718046b345a6e3b671 OP_EQUAL
address
MSQRy4g1A7eXafgxeN7FTK7LF8S19wZj6x
transaction
5435a83da4eeb69845a01675686a3007811821b177d056ff4a8ad50d4968578c
spent
true